Industrial air compressors are designed to keep up with heavy-duty tasks, from inflating tractor tires to driving nail guns, sanders, and paint sprayers. They’re a staple for anyone who needs steady, high-pressure air for long stretches of time, and that’s why you’ll find them in everything from local garages to large-scale manufacturing plants. These machines come in different types, like rotary screw compressors for all-day use and reciprocating compressors for jobs that don’t need constant air flow. Each type has its strengths, so it’s worth thinking about what fits your needs best before you buy.
When you’re hunting for a commercial air compressor, it’s smart to think about more than just the price tag. Look at the CFM (cubic feet per minute) and PSI (pounds per square inch) ratings to make sure your compressor can handle the tools and jobs you’ve got lined up. If you’re running multiple tools at once or powering equipment that needs a steady stream of air, you’ll want a model built for continuous use—something with a high duty cycle that can keep up without skipping a beat. Maintenance is another thing to keep in mind, especially in the colder months when equipment tends to get a little more stubborn. Easy-access filters, oil sight glasses, and sturdy tanks can save you a lot of headaches down the road. And don’t forget about energy efficiency—modern industrial air compressors are a lot easier on the electric bill than older models, which is good news for anyone looking to cut costs without sacrificing performance.
